Output 0166a3e4aba4db1da49ba7c895e5cc30c124b5716337045a9d719368a7a90384:11

value
20087956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c699056b86ae35b3c2918cee22b2331468973c54 OP_EQUAL
address
3Ko72d83CA6qJ3bGbzhbq1TmrjKDsQBoYk
transaction
0166a3e4aba4db1da49ba7c895e5cc30c124b5716337045a9d719368a7a90384
spent
true